One UI 8: Samsung’s Galaxy Watch browser and lockdown mode get a fresh look

Samsung One UI 8

Samsung is rolling out exciting updates for Galaxy devices with One UI 8, bringing a modern touch to the Galaxy Watch’s Samsung Internet browser and a smoother Lockdown Mode on phones. These changes aim to make your experience more user-friendly and visually appealing.

The Samsung Internet browser on the Galaxy Watch is getting a sleek makeover with One UI 8 Watch, based on Wear OS 6. It now features updated icons with vibrant colors and a clean design that matches the phone’s One UI 7 style. The browser’s layout is more intuitive, making it easier to navigate on your wrist.

While some icons have a white background in leaks, the final version might tweak this for a unified look. This update, expected in July 2025, will likely debut with the Galaxy Watch 8 series, with a beta program starting soon for Watch 7 and Ultra users.

On Galaxy phones, One UI 8 enhances Lockdown Mode with a subtle, smoother animation. Spotted on a Galaxy S25 Ultra, this update refines the transition when you activate the mode, keeping the side key menu familiar but more polished.

It’s a small but noticeable improvement, making the security feature feel more seamless. These updates show Samsung’s focus on blending style and function. The One UI 8 beta is tipped for June 2025, starting with the Galaxy S25 series, promising a polished experience across devices.
